Interface TwissInitialConditions
-
- All Superinterfaces:
EditableOpticPoint,OpticPoint
- All Known Implementing Classes:
TwissInitialConditionsImpl
public interface TwissInitialConditions extends EditableOpticPoint
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description voidaddListener(TwissListener listener)java.lang.DoublegetDeltap()java.util.List<MadxTwissVariable>getMadxVariables()java.lang.DoublegetPt()java.lang.DoublegetPtcBetz()java.lang.IntegergetPtcMapOrder()java.lang.IntegergetPtcPhaseSpaceDimension()java.lang.StringgetSaveBetaName()java.lang.DoublegetT()java.lang.DoublegetValue(MadxTwissVariable var)booleanisCalcAtCenter()booleanisCalcChromaticFunctions()booleanisClosedOrbit()voidremoveListener(TwissListener listener)voidsetCalcAtCenter(boolean calcAtCentre)voidsetCalcChromaticFunctions(boolean calcChromaticFunctions)voidsetClosedOrbit(boolean closedOrbit)voidsetDeltap(java.lang.Double deltap)voidsetPt(java.lang.Double pt)voidsetPtcBetz(java.lang.Double betz)voidsetPtcMapOrder(java.lang.Integer order)voidsetPtcPhaseSpaceDimension(java.lang.Integer dim)voidsetSaveBetaName(java.lang.String saveBetaName)voidsetT(java.lang.Double t)
-
-
-
Method Detail
-
getPtcPhaseSpaceDimension
java.lang.Integer getPtcPhaseSpaceDimension()
-
setPtcPhaseSpaceDimension
void setPtcPhaseSpaceDimension(java.lang.Integer dim)
-
getPtcMapOrder
java.lang.Integer getPtcMapOrder()
-
setPtcMapOrder
void setPtcMapOrder(java.lang.Integer order)
-
getPtcBetz
java.lang.Double getPtcBetz()
-
setPtcBetz
void setPtcBetz(java.lang.Double betz)
-
getDeltap
java.lang.Double getDeltap()
-
setDeltap
void setDeltap(java.lang.Double deltap)
-
setCalcChromaticFunctions
void setCalcChromaticFunctions(boolean calcChromaticFunctions)
- Parameters:
calcChromaticFunctions- the calcChromaticFunctions to set
-
isCalcChromaticFunctions
boolean isCalcChromaticFunctions()
- Returns:
- the calcChromaticFunctions
-
setClosedOrbit
void setClosedOrbit(boolean closedOrbit)
- Parameters:
closedOrbit- the closedOrbit to set
-
isClosedOrbit
boolean isClosedOrbit()
- Returns:
- the closedOrbit
-
setCalcAtCenter
void setCalcAtCenter(boolean calcAtCentre)
- Parameters:
calcAtCentre- the calcAtCentre to set
-
isCalcAtCenter
boolean isCalcAtCenter()
- Returns:
- the calcAtCenter
-
getT
java.lang.Double getT()
-
setT
void setT(java.lang.Double t)
-
getPt
java.lang.Double getPt()
-
setPt
void setPt(java.lang.Double pt)
-
getMadxVariables
java.util.List<MadxTwissVariable> getMadxVariables()
-
getValue
java.lang.Double getValue(MadxTwissVariable var)
- Specified by:
getValuein interfaceOpticPoint
-
setSaveBetaName
void setSaveBetaName(java.lang.String saveBetaName)
-
getSaveBetaName
java.lang.String getSaveBetaName()
-
addListener
void addListener(TwissListener listener)
-
removeListener
void removeListener(TwissListener listener)
-
-